EAA1114 is a 501(c)(3) charitable organization that offers something for every aviation interest in central North Carolina: homebuilding, vintage, warbirds, ultralights, fly-ins, fly-outs, workshops, aviation history and good old hangar flying.

Our Chapter has again been approved to select a Ray Aviation Scholarship candidate - the process allows us to select a student pilot aged 16 to 19 who will compete for a scholarship of up to $10,000 towards training for a Private pilot certificate. EAA Chapter 1114 has one of the world's leading Young Eagles programs With over 17,000 kids flown! We have numerous nationally recognized coordinators and volunteers. For details on upcoming rallies, see our YOUNG EAGLES page.
